Table 2.

Environmental characteristics of the sampled residential properties.

Environmental variables Mean ± SD Range

Continuous variables
Percent forest within residential parcel 49 ± 26 11–100
Percent forest within 500 m of residential parcel 32 ± 13 9–59
Percent forest within 1 km of residential parcel 27 ± 13 8–55
Forest edge density within 500 m of residential parcel (m/hectare) 105 ± 22 57–140
Forest edge density within 1 km of residential parcel (m/hectare) 85 ± 21 44–119
Total property area (m2) 11,222 ± 5725 4076–26,019

Dichotomous variables Percent of residences (n)

Signs of deer on property 88 (21)
Presence of fence on property 21 (5)
Compost pile on property 50 (12)
Log pile on property 92 (22)
Bird/squirrel feeder on property 67 (16)
Dominant forest type
 Deciduous 67 (16)
 Coniferous 4 (1)
 Mixed deciduous/conifer 30 (7)
